## Further Reading

Per-tenant rate quotas in Quillbase are enforced at the gateway layer and reconciled nightly against the billing ledger. Release managers should note that quota changes ship in their own deploy train and require a 24-hour bake window before general rollout. Overrides granted during incidents expire automatically after seven days. For the quota schema, the override approval flow, and the rollout calendar, see the internal reference page maintained by the platform team:

runbook for hawif-tajeg: https://grafana.plorvasoft.example/dash

## Dark Mode — Theming Notes

Welcome to the Larkspur admin dashboard. Dark mode is driven by a token layer, not per-component overrides, so please avoid hardcoding hex values anywhere in the panel views. The theme resolver reads the user preference first, then the OS setting, and caches the result for the session. Contrast ratios were audited by the Fennwick accessibility group last quarter. The resolver's behavior is governed by the constants below.

tuning table, faduf-baduf:
PRIORITIES = {
    "ulavan": 191,
    "silys": 750,
    "goriel": 238,
    "kelmir": 66,
    "wendor": 432,
}

Subject: Orders soft-delete handover

Hey Rinna,

Quick one before review: the `orders` table on Glimmershop now uses a `deleted_at` column instead of hard deletes. All reads must filter on it — check the new view does this. Backfill finished last night. To verify on staging, connect with the string below.

primary connection of yagep-kahip = redis://giliel_svc:zYiKsLL2PLpfPL@db-348f.xolmarsys.corp:5432/fenwyn

// Catalog cache invalidation client for Shopletto support tooling.
// When an agent edits a product, this client pings the Fernwick
// invalidation service so stale prices don't linger in the catalog
// cache. Invalidation is per-SKU; bulk flushes need manager approval.
// The client authenticates with the internal key on the next line.

app token of yajeg-kawef = kto11_7En3XSX8xQw